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software helps organizations in successfully managing consumer interactions, improving processes, and enhancing general consumer experience. CRM software, with its innovative abilities, helps business successfully handle customer information in a centralized database. This enables organizations to adequately see each client's history, preferences, and interactions across various touchpoints.
The cloud sector represented the biggest market share of over 55% in 2024. The demand for cloud-based enterprise software is increasing substantially as it can be hosted on the vendor's servers and accessed remotely from any location. Cloud-based software application gets rid of the need for regular manual updates of software services in enterprises and makes it possible for users to access information easily from any place.
Cloud-based software uses numerous services, including system personalization, data backup, threat defense, and automated software application upgrades, which support companies in automating their workflows. The on-premise segment is expected to grow at a substantial rate throughout the projection period. The on-premise enterprise software application is witnessing ample demand from various organizations owing to the rising focus of companies on compliance and information security.
On-premise software solutions provide improved personalization and combination abilities, offering higher control over sensitive data and ensuring adherence to industry guidelines. The need for enterprise software in the health care sector is increasing significantly owing to the rising emphasis on digital improvement, data-driven decision-making, and improved client care. Healthcare organizations such as hospitals, centers, and medical institutions are acknowledging the requirement for sophisticated software application services to simplify operations, boost client outcomes, and adhere to rigid regulatory requirements.

In Might 2024, Capgemini, a worldwide leader in consulting, technology, and digital transformation solutions and services, revealed the acquisition of Syniti, a provider of business information management software and services specializing in offering platform and migration options.
In June 2023, TIBCO Software application Inc.'s holding business, Cloud Software application Group, revealed a partnership with Midis Group. The partnership was focused on guaranteeing regional resources to satisfy clients' needs and drive the scalability required to expand the company's reach in the Middle East, Eastern Europe, and African regions. Midis Group is a group of 170 companies in 70 countries globally, which uses managed IT and assessment services.
